Regarding the TDA4VEN I have the following questions:
-
USB3SS (USB1) Subsystem: For the TDA4VEN-Q1 USB3SS (USB1) subsystem, does Device/Peripheral mode support SuperSpeed (5 Gbps), or is Device mode limited to High Speed (480 Mbps)? The USB3SS capability list in the TRM appears to show SuperSpeed under Host only.
-
Decoupling Caps: Where can decoupling cap recommendations for TDA4VEN power be found?
-
OLDI (unused feature): If OLDI is not being used, what is the recommended pin connection for its power pin VDDA1P8_OLDI0? Should it be left unconnected?
-
SERDES Block – REFCLK for PCIe only: Is the external SERDES REFCLK (REFCLK_P/N) required ONLY for PCIe? For a design with no PCIe, can these pins be left unused?
-
SERDES Block – SGMII clocking: Can the SERDES CORE_REF_CLK be sourced from the internal MAIN_PLL2_HSDIV0 for SGMII, and does the internal reference meet SGMII jitter requirements without an external REFCLK?
-
SERDES Block – USB3 clocking: Can the SERDES run USB3 from an internal reference, or does USB3 SuperSpeed require an external low-jitter REFCLK? If external is required, what frequency/jitter spec applies?
-
SERDES Block – PCIe clock output: Can the SoC (as PCIe Root Port) source a PCIe clock output on SERDES REFCLK (REFCLK_P/N) for the endpoint device while meeting PCIe jitter spec?
-
SERDES Block – Unused REFCLK termination: If REFCLK_P/N is left unused (internal clocking used instead), how should these pins be terminated?
